| John Connewarre, Victoria, Australia 2013-05-30 00:22:00 Auction/eBay Scam Gumtree | +1 Email scam After listing a used car on Gumtree, a text message came on the phone. \"Please tell me of the condition of the car and your best price, please contact me at the following email kyliehuitchinson@outlook .com\". I replied and of course I got a message back wanting bank details paypal details as they didn\'t have access to their visa accounts etc etc etc. Needless to say I did not reply and blocked the person or scammer from my inbox. |
